Implementing Security Measures
Firewalls and Intrusion Detection Systems
Firewalls and intrusion detection systems are critical components of a comprehensive security strategy. He must configure these tools to monitor and control network traffic effectively. Proper configuration is essential.
Additionally, firewalls can prevent unauthorized access to sensitive financial data. This protection is vital for maintaining client trust. Trust is everything in finance. Regular updates and monitoring enhance their effectiveness. Consistent vigilance is necessary.
Data Encryption Techniques
Data encryption techniques are indispensable for protecting sensitive information. He should implement strong algorithms, such as AES or RSA, to secure data. Strong algorithms matter. Additionally, using encryption for data at rest and in transit is crucial. This dual approach enhances overall security.
Moreover, regular key management practices must be established. Proper key management prevents unauthorized access. Awareness is key in security. Training staff on encryption protocols can further mitigate risks. Education empowers employees.

Incident Response Planning
Developing an Incident Responsr Plan
Developing an incident response plan is essential for mitigating risks. It outlines procedures for addressing security breaches. A well-structured plan minimizes potential financial losses. He must identify key stakeholders and their roles. Clear communication channels enhance response efficiency.
Additionally, regular testing of the plan is crucial. This ensures that all team members are prepared. Statistics indicate that organizations with plans recover faster. Are they ready for a crisis? Continuous updates reflect evolving threats and technologies.
Roles and Responsibilities During an Incident
During an incident, clearly defined roles and responsibilities are crucial. Each team member must understand their specific tasks. This clarity enhances the overall response effectiveness. He should prioritize communication among stakeholders. Effective coordination minimizes confusion and delays.
Key roles may include the incident commander, communication lead, and technical experts. Each role contributes to a comprehensive response strategy. Regular training ensures everyone is prepared. Are they aware of their responsibilities? A well-prepared team can significantly reduce impact.
